Apply to a Health Program
Applying To a Health Technology ProgramEach year more people apply for admission to the Selective Health Technology programs than we have the capabilities to serve. Enrollments may be limited due to the lack of available resources and facilities within the community and institution. We follow a selective admission policy based upon the criteria outlined in the "GUIDELINES FOR SELECTIVE ADMISSION PROGRAMS" section of the 2007-2008 Bluegrass Community and Technical College Catalog. The strength of the applicant pool varies year to year, with the best qualified applicants receiving first consideration. Although entry to the clinical courses of the health programs is based on a selective admission process, applicants can be considered "health pending" students by selecting a health pending major code for question 13 on the application. A health pending student can take all of the courses within the curriculum to satisfy graduation requirements, except the clinical courses. Please note, however, that enrollment as a health pending student does not guarantee admission to the clinical courses of the curriculum. A health pending program applicant must follow the deadlines published for general admission into the college. In order to be considered for admission to the clinical courses of the health program, we must receive admission documents and requirements by the February 15, 2008 deadline. An applicant will not be considered for admission into the clinical courses of the health program if the admission file is incomplete and/or the applicant fails to meet our special program requirements (for example, mandatory conferences or work/observation experience) by the deadline. To obtain more information about applying to a health program, please refer to the 2007-2008 Bluegrass Community and Technical College Catalog. It is the student’s responsibility to obtain and follow the information provided in the catalog.
